<p><strong><em>1. Coronado Cougars (5-6) -</em></strong> The Coronado Cougars are first in my power rankings despite their losing record. They have gone out and faced many of the top teams in the country since the beginning of the season. Although they've fallen to a few of the teams, they've still picked up quality wins and recently had some success at the John Wall Classic out on the East Coast. They also notably took down Centennial (CA) last night 70-63 in overtime. [player_tooltip player_id='1406767' first='Munir' last='Greig'] has been a steady force for them, and is currently averaging 15.2 PPG, 8 RPG, and 3.2 APG. His ability to get downhill has truly stood out. [player_tooltip player_id='1490283' first='Amare' last='Oba'], (13.2 PPG) [player_tooltip player_id='2484289' first='Devaughn' last='Dorrough'] (10.6 PPG), and [player_tooltip player_id='1463264' first='Jonny' last='Collins'] (10.1 PPG) have also been reliable contributors on the offensive end. On defense, the Cougars have looked to [player_tooltip player_id='2509672' first='Siyahe' last='Siaisiai'] and [player_tooltip player_id='1707488' first='Demari' last='Hunter'] to create turnovers. Siaisiai is currently averaging an impressive 2.8 BPG, while Hunter averages 2.1 SPG. Overall, they're a well rounded team and they have the athleticism to run with anyone. Now that conference play is here, it will be interesting to see how they continue to evolve. They will face Mojave on 1/8 and Bishop Gorman on 1/10.</p>

<p><strong><em>2. Bishop Gorman Gaels (9-7) -</em></strong> The Bishop Gorman Gaels are a very role oriented team this season, and their unselfish play has helped them compete against top tier squads. They ended up going 2-2 in the High School Division at the Tarkanian Classic. With wins over Carter (TX) and Hillgrove (GA). They also hung right with Santa Margarita. And went all the way to double overtime with them. But Santa Margarita ultimately pulled away. Even though they lost, their starters and rotational players performed well. So far, [player_tooltip player_id='2086139' first='Tyler' last='Johnson'] and [player_tooltip player_id='2047786' first='Kameron' last='Cooper'] have been doing much of the scoring. But their seniors, [player_tooltip player_id='2370258' first='Dino' last='Roberts'] and [player_tooltip player_id='1266706' first='Tyler' last='Bright'], capitalize on their opportunities. Other players that have pitched in are: [player_tooltip player_id='1965271' first='Hudson' last='Dannels'], [player_tooltip player_id='2691549' first='Canon' last='Mullen'], [player_tooltip player_id='2450360' first='Noah' last='Grossman'], [player_tooltip player_id='2654821' first='Braylen' last='Williams'], and [player_tooltip player_id='2374170' first='Dillon' last='Ritchie']. Considering their strength of schedule and their depth. They look like a team that's progressing and there's a good chance they'll be in a position to contend for a State Title. </p>

<p><strong><em>3. Democracy Prep Blue Knights (8-6) - </em></strong>The Democracy Prep Blue Knights will be a dangerous squad to face in 5A this month. Like the Cougars and Gaels, they put together a very tough non-conference schedule in November and December. While they took some L's along the way, they did notably beat Mayfair (CA) at the Jordan Take Flight Flight Challenge. And they were also the one of just two teams to make it to their bracket Championship at the Tarkanian Classic a couple of weeks ago. I was able to catch their semifinal game against Southwind, and their speed caught my attention. Then I watched them go toe to toe with JSerra in the championship. Players like [player_tooltip player_id='2468244' first='Jaden' last='Redding'] (11.6 PPG) and [player_tooltip player_id='1667943' first='Zyon' last='Harris'] (11 PPG) were consistent playmakers on the offensive end for them. And I also liked what I saw from [player_tooltip player_id='2374248' first='Dashaun' last='Harris'] (8.4 PPG), [player_tooltip player_id='1945840' first='Ien' last='Kirkland'] (7.6 PPG), [player_tooltip player_id='1529853' first='Tai' last='Coleman'] (11.0 PPG), [player_tooltip player_id='2434274' first='Elizjah' last='Scott'] (5 PPG) [player_tooltip player_id='1667541' first='Mario' last='Allen'] (4 PPG), and [player_tooltip player_id='2122232' first='Kaden' last='Arnold'] (17.6 PPG). With high level athletes at every position, they can make opposing teams pay in transition and tire the defense with their relentless pace. Their next 3 games are against Desert Pines (1/13), Coronado (1/14), and Mesa (AZ) (1/17). </p>

<p><strong><em>4. Desert Pines Jaguars (11-4) - </em></strong>The Desert Pines Jaguars won their first 8 games of the season. They took down Clark, Mater East Academy, Crossroads (CA), and Palisades (CA) during that run. They then faced off against Lone Peak (UT) at the Orleans Arena and just about clinched a bracket championship birth. But unfortunately for them, Lone Peak made some clutch plays with just moments to go in regulation and OT to come out on top. Although they didn't get the win, sophomore guard [player_tooltip player_id='2374347' first='Aaron' last='McMorran II'] (25.2 PPG) picked up his second Division I offer from Murray St. after posting 30 points and 11 rebounds. [player_tooltip player_id='1707443' first='Chase' last='Robertson'] (12.4 PPG) and [player_tooltip player_id='2111894' first='Tyler' last='Merto'] (13.4 PPG) have also been leading the way for the Jaguars. Robertson had a monster 30 point game against Palisades. And Merto has had couple of 20 point performances (coming against San Gabriel Academy and Aquinas). Beyond their core of scorers, they've also had [player_tooltip player_id='2588076' first='Maleki' last='Sims'] (4.2 PPG), Lavelle Lovelace (7.4 PPG), [player_tooltip player_id='2812155' first='Mason' last='Robles'] (6.9 PPG), Jerome Jackson Sequeira (2.4 PPG), [player_tooltip player_id='1965276' first='Quentin' last='Stewart'] (1.7 PPG), and [player_tooltip player_id='2634178' first='Kru' last='Brown'] (1.4) all step up at times on offense and on defense. All in all, they are a gritty group and we'll see if they can keep it going. As they are set to face Bishop Gorman (1/7), Las Vegas (1/9), and Liberty (1/10) this week. </p>

<p><strong><em>5. Liberty Patriots (10-5) -</em></strong> The Liberty Patriots are already at 10 wins. Much of that has to do with their stellar senior class. [player_tooltip player_id='1463230' first='Tyus' last='Thomas'] (16.2 PPG), [player_tooltip player_id='1493480' first='Dante' last='Steward'] (16.5 PPG), [player_tooltip player_id='2145851' first='Evan' last='Hilliard'] (8.7 PPG), [player_tooltip player_id='1766694' first='Nick' last='Evans'] (4.8 PPG), [player_tooltip player_id='2640655' first='Eric' last='Alisca'] (2.8 PPG), Da'aron Thompkins (9.3 PPG) and [player_tooltip player_id='1463237' first='Tayshawn' last='Caesar'] (10.8 PPG) all bring a great deal of experience to the table. Thomas and Steward are both capable outside shooters and either one of them can go off on any given night. When I watched them play against Durango, their team defense also stood out. Each player seems to play with a ton of effort. And just about everyone can cause a turnover. As a whole, they have the pieces to battle against some of these other stacked 5A teams. Their notable wins are over Clark, Modesto Christian (CA), Pasadena (CA), and Etiwanda (CA). Look for them to be in some real duels in January. The next 3 games on their schedule are: Faith Lutheran (1/6), Centennial (1/8), and Desert Pines (1/10).</p>
